Question | Answer |
deforestation cycles back to | primary succession |
Ecological succession | process by which an existing an existing ecosystem is gradually replaced by another |
Climax community | relatively stable collection of plants and animals |
there is no soil in | primary succession |
lichens are initial species in | primary succession |
the process is slower in | primary succession |
the process is faster in | secondary succesion |
there is soil in | secondary succesion |
populations have characteristics such as | food chains and types of graphs |
types of graphs | s - curve, j - curve |
j - curve | exponential growth |
s - curve | limiting factors and carrying capacity |
food chains consist of | producers, decomposers, and consumers |
the 3 kinds of consumers are | primary, secondary, and tertiary consumers |
Nutrients in biosphere | nitrogen, oxygen, carbon, phosphorous |
Autotrophs | manufacture carbohydrates, proteins, fats, vitamins |
Heterotrophs | consume plants and animals |
Ecology is | study of living things and the natural environment |
10% rule | Only 10% of the energy at one trophic level can be used at the next trophic level |
Trophic levels | feeding level |
First trophic level | producers |
Second trophic level | primary consumers |
Food web | complex feeding relationships from interconnected food chains |
Food chain | sequence of organisms related to one another through predator-prey relationship |
Omnivores | eat everything |
Herbivores | eat plants |
Carnivores | eat animals |
Plants are | producers |
Heterotrophs | are consumers |
